Establishes a rent increase exemption for certain nonprofit organizations; provides a tax abatement for limiting rent increases on nonprofit.
New York State Senate bill S01091 amends the real property tax law to establish a tax abatement for nonprofit organizations in cities with a population of one million or more. The bill provides a reduction in real property taxes for eligible buildings that contain premises occupied by nonprofit organizations. The abatement is contingent on the landlord entering into a ten-year lease with a renewal clause limiting rent increases to no more than three percent annually. The bill also includes provisions for enforcement, reporting requirements, and confidentiality of information.
